House window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ows or installing new ones in a home. This process typically includes removing old or damaged windows, preparing the window openings, and fitting new windows securely to ensure proper operation and aesthetics. Skilled contractors will handle measurements, selection of appropriate window types, and the installation process to help homeowners achieve a finished look that enhances both the appearance and functionality of their property.
One common reason homeowners seek window installation services is to address issues such as drafts, condensation, or difficulty opening and closing windows. These problems can lead to increased energy costs, reduced comfort, and potential security concerns. Installing new, energy-efficient windows can help improve insulation, reduce noise infiltration, and increase the overall value of a property.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s or replacements in Haines City range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window size and type.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um, which is reserved for more involved repairs.
Full Window Replacement - Replacing an entire window unit us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 per window. Larger, more complex projects or custom designs can exceed this range, but most standard replacements stay within it.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ific window styles and sizes.
Multiple Window Installations - Installing several windows at once often results in a total cost of $3,000 to $8,000 for many homes in the area. Many projects in this category are priced toward the middle of the range, with larger or more elaborate installations reaching higher totals.
Custom or Specialty Windows - Specialty windows such as bay, bow, or impact-resistant models can cost $2,500 to $5,000 or more per unit. These projects are less common and tend to fall into the higher end of the pricing spectrum, reflecting their complexity and material requ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ing service providers for house window installation in Haines City, FL,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a proven track record of successfully handling window installations comparable to their specific needs. This can include experience with different types of windows, various home styles, or particular challenges common in the area. A contractor’s familiarity with local building codes and climate considerations can also be a helpful indicator of their ability to deliver quality results.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any relevant warranties or guarantees. Having this information in writing helps ensure everyone is aligned on project details and can serve as a reference throughout the process. It’s also advisable to ask for reputable references or examples of past work, which can provide insight into the contractor’s reliability and quality of craftsmanship.
